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Nutrient Tank Circulation System

Selecting the right nutrient tank circulation system depends on your specific environment—be it a hydroponic garden or an aquatic tank—and your comfort with technology. Key considerations include capacity, control features, ease of setup, and intended use. Understanding these factors helps identify the best system for your needs, whether you prioritize automation, capacity, or precise water movement.

Understanding Your Environment

First, determine whether you need a system for hydroponic plant growth or aquatic water movement. Hydroponic systems benefit from circulation that promotes nutrient delivery and oxygenation, while aquarium circulation impacts water quality and aquatic life health. The size and complexity of your environment will influence your choice, with larger or more delicate systems requiring more robust circulation options.

Key Features to Consider

Look for adjustable flow rates, capacity (tank size or number of pods), and control options such as app connectivity or manual controls. For hydroponics, features like customizable lighting and cycle timers support plant development. For aquariums, wave modes and quiet operation are beneficial. Balance these features against ease of use and your technical comfort level.

Ease of Setup and Maintenance

Systems with smart controls or app integration typically offer greater convenience but may require familiarity with technology. Simpler models might need manual adjustments but are easier to set up and troubleshoot. Consider your experience level and whether you prefer plug-and-play or customizable solutions.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main difference between hydroponic and aquarium circulation systems?

Hydroponic circulation systems focus on delivering nutrients and oxygen efficiently to plants, often emphasizing adjustable flow and lighting controls. Aquarium circulation systems, like wave makers, prioritize creating natural water currents to support aquatic life, with features like wave modes and adjustable flow rates to simulate natural environments. While both involve water movement, their design and control features cater to very different needs.

How important is app control in a nutrient tank circulation system?

App control significantly enhances convenience and customization, allowing users to automate schedules, adjust flow or lighting remotely, and monitor system performance easily. For tech-savvy users or those managing complex setups, app control can save time and improve system efficiency. However, it also introduces dependency on WiFi stability and may complicate setup for beginners.
